Cygwin

Description: Cygwin is a Linux-like environment and command-line interface for Windows. It provides functionality similar to a Linux distribution on Windows, allowing you to port software running on POSIX systems and run it natively on Windows.

Landscape

Description: Landscape is an open source systems management and monitoring tool developed by Canonical for deploying, managing, and monitoring Ubuntu servers. It features auto-deployment, configuration management, and security updates.
